FALSE | Claim By Jim Jordan (R): Don’t remember seeing this many flight delays during the Trump Administration.
Evidence: Weather events, air carrier and air system issues, prior flight delays, or airport security issues can cause delays. There were 1,176,657 flight delays in 2019, the most during Donald Trump’s presidency. So far, the highest number of flight delays during Biden’s presidency is 1,132,113 for 2022. MBFC rating: False |
